Ge Alstom scn666 - Thyristor Firing Card 3bea0103

The Ge Alstom scn666 is a robust and versatile automation product engineered to meet the demanding requirements of the power industry, petrochemical plants, and general automation sectors. Renowned for its reliability and superior performance, the scn666 serves as a pivotal component in industrial automation systems where precision, durability, and efficiency are critical. A key technical feature of the Ge Alstom scn666 is its impressive input/output capacity, designed to handle complex control signals with exceptional accuracy. The unit supports a wide range of input voltages and current levels, ensuring seamless integration with various industrial equipment. Its output capabilities are finely tuned to deliver consistent performance, maintaining operational stability even under heavy load conditions.


This makes the scn666 ideal for controlling processes in harsh industrial environments. Additionally, the product is engineered with enhanced durability, employing high-grade materials and advanced manufacturing techniques to withstand extreme temperatures, vibration, and electromagnetic interference, common in petrochemical plants and power generation facilities. Performance-wise, the scn666 excels with rapid response times and minimal latency, enabling real-time monitoring and control. This efficiency translates into improved process uptime and reduced maintenance costs, vital for industries where downtime equates to significant financial losses. The unit’s compatibility with existing automation frameworks allows for straightforward upgrades and expansions, enhancing system flexibility and future-proofing investments.


In practical applications, the Ge Alstom scn666 is frequently deployed in power industry settings such as thermal power plants, where it controls and monitors turbine operations and grid synchronization. In the petrochemical sector, it manages process automation tasks including pressure regulation, flow control, and safety interlocks. The general automation market benefits from its adaptability in manufacturing lines, material handling, and complex assembly operations, where precision control can significantly boost productivity and product quality.
